如何设置phpmyadmin访问密码

 我来答
或少路西法
2017-02-06 · TA获得超过120个赞
知道小有建树答主
回答量:480
采纳率:0%
帮助的人:404万
展开全部
PHPMYADMIN的帐号,实际上就是你用来访问mysql数据库的帐号。

现在你要搞清楚的是,PHPMYADMIN、你的网站、网站的数据库,这三者完全有可能不在同一台机器上。如果你仅仅要修改密码,可以直接用phpmyadmin来修改。在phpmyadmin进入之后的右侧界面中,选择“权限”,在列出的用户中找到自己的用户,点“编辑”修改即可。

不过,如果方便的话,还是到mysql数据库服务器上修改好一些。这样既可以修改用户名也可以修改密码。mysql数据库可以本地登陆,也可以远程登录。总之,你得以管理员的身份登陆数据库,然后依次输入以下命令:
>>use mysql; //打开数据库
>>update user set user='新用户名' where user='旧用户名';
>>update user set password=password("新密码") where user='新用户名';

>>flush privileges; //刷新用户权限表

然后即可修改成功。
兄弟连教育
2017-02-06 · 百度知道合伙人官方认证企业
兄弟连教育
兄弟连教育成立于2006年,11年来专注IT职业教育,是国内专业的IT技术培训学校。2016年成功挂牌新三板(股票代码:839467)市值过亿。开设专注程序员培训专注php、Java、UI、云计算、Python、HTML5、
向TA提问
展开全部
  • 首先建议大家检查一下自己是否设置了一系列的安全账号,进入linux系统的命令终端,输入:sudo /opt/lampp/lampp security


  • 然后就会出现一些列的账号设置,大家一路设置下去就行,总体设置如下所示:

  • XAMPP: Quick security check...

  • XAMPP: Your XAMPP pages are NOT secured by a password.

  • XAMPP: Do you want to set a password? [yes] yes (1)

  • XAMPP: Password: ******

  • XAMPP: Password (again): ******

  • XAMPP: Password protection active. Please use 'lampp' as user name!

  • XAMPP: MySQL is accessable via network.

  • XAMPP: Normaly that's not recommended. Do you want me to turn it off? [yes] yes

  • XAMPP: Turned off.

  • XAMPP: Stopping MySQL...

  • XAMPP: Starting MySQL...

  • XAMPP: The MySQL/phpMyAdmin user pma has no password set!!!

  • XAMPP: Do you want to set a password? [yes] yes

  • XAMPP: Password: ******

  • XAMPP: Password (again): ******

  • XAMPP: Setting new MySQL pma password.

  • XAMPP: Setting phpMyAdmin's pma password to the new one.

  • XAMPP: MySQL has no root passwort set!!!

  • XAMPP: Do you want to set a password? [yes] yes

  • XAMPP: Write the passworde somewhere down to make sure you won't forget it!!!

  • XAMPP: Password: ******

  • XAMPP: Password (again): ******

  • XAMPP: Setting new MySQL root password.

  • XAMPP: Setting phpMyAdmin's root password to the new one.

  • XAMPP: The FTP password for user 'nobody' is still set to 'lampp'.

  • XAMPP: Do you want to change the password? [yes] yes

  • XAMPP: Password: ******

  • XAMPP: Password (again): ******

  • XAMPP: Reload ProFTPD...

  • XAMPP: Done.


  • 如果设置完毕之后(最好先重启lampp服务),还是不能通过账号和密码访问phpmyadmin,那么需要修改一个文件。

  • 打开phpMyAdmin根目录下的config.inc.php,按照以下行修改就可以了:

  • 把$cfgServers[$i]['auth_type']= 'config';修改成:

  • $cfgServers[$i]['auth_type']= 'cookie';


  • 保存文件,重新访问phpmyadmin就可以使用账号的密码了。

  • 如下图所示:

  • END

  • 注意事项

  • 这里的配置参数共有三种,分别为cookie,config和http;

  • config的意思是: 把mysql用户名和密码直接填入config.inc.php,不显示登录界面,直接进入管理界面;

  • http : 使用HTTP认证,如果是使用IIS+PHP的方式,则HTTP认证是无效的,这个功能只能在APACHE服务器环境下使用。

  • cookie : 使用COOKIE登录认证, 一般情况下,都是使用的COOKIE方式。


已赞过 已踩过<
你对这个回答的评价是?
评论 收起
百度网友e2d33c0fbe
2017-02-06 · TA获得超过1.7万个赞
知道大有可为答主
回答量:1.1万
采纳率:2%
帮助的人:7384万
展开全部
PHPMYADMIN的帐号,实际上就是你用来访问mysql数据库的帐号。

现在你要搞清楚的是,PHPMYADMIN、你的网站、网站的数据库,这三者完全有可能不在同一台机器上。如果你仅仅要修改密码,可以直接用phpmyadmin来修改。在phpmyadmin进入之后的右侧界面中,选择“权限”,在列出的用户中找到自己的用户,点“编辑”修改即可。

不过,如果方便的话,还是到mysql数据库服务器上修改好一些。这样既可以修改用户名也可以修改密码。mysql数据库可以本地登陆,也可以远程登录。总之,你得以管理员的身份登陆数据库,然后依次输入以下命令:
>>use mysql; //打开数据库
>>update user set user='新用户名' where user='旧用户名';
>>update user set password=password("新密码") where user='新用户名';

>>flush privileges; //刷新用户权限表

然后即可修改成功。
回答不容易,希望能帮到您,满意请帮忙采纳一下,谢谢 !
本回答被提问者采纳
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
匿名用户
2017-02-14
展开全部
如果忘记密码,你大可一键强制改密即可,
你可以使用PHPWAMP集成环境内置的强制改密功能

强制改掉mysql数据库密码,一键改密教程http://jingyan.baidu.com/article/1612d500ba6ea4e20e1eeed3.html
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
收起 更多回答(2)
推荐律师服务: 若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询

为你推荐:

下载百度知道APP,抢鲜体验
使用百度知道APP,立即抢鲜体验。你的手机镜头里或许有别人想知道的答案。
扫描二维码下载
×

类别

我们会通过消息、邮箱等方式尽快将举报结果通知您。

说明

0/200

提交
取消

辅 助

模 式